4 ounces for every 16 ounces. Rate or ratio and in simplest form

Mathematics
2 answers:
Bess [88]3 years ago
8 0

4 for 16 would be written as 4/16.

Dividing both numbers by 4 it is simplified to 1/4

geniusboy [140]3 years ago
3 0

4 ounces for every 16 ounces can be written as:

\displaystyle \frac{4}{16} =\frac{1}{4}

As a ratio, it can be expressed as:

1:4

0=14pi/9 radians to degrees
DIA [1.3K]

Answer:

280 degrees

Step-by-step explanation:

To change radians to degrees, we can use the conversion factor

180/pi

14 pi/9  * 180/pi

Canceling like terms

14/9 * 180

280 degrees

Given a mean of 24.5 and a standard deviation of 1.7 what is the z score of the value 24 rounded to the nearest tenth?
Softa [21]
The correct answer is B) -0.3

Z-scores are found using the formula

z = (X-μ)/σ

For this problem, we have

z = (24-24.5)/1.7 = -0.5/1.7 = -0.3
